AI Summary
- Authorizes the City of Cartersville to levy an excise tax of up to 6% on charges for hotel rooms, motel rooms, lodgings, and other short-term accommodations furnished within the city, pursuant to O.C.G.A. § 48-13-51(b).
- Follows a resolution adopted by the Cartersville governing authority on March 18, 2010, specifying the tax rate, eligible projects, and allocation of proceeds.
- Requires that at least 50% of tax revenue collected above the 5% rate be spent on promoting tourism, conventions, and trade shows through the city's designated destination marketing organization.
- Directs the remaining revenue collected above the 5% rate to be used for tourism product development.
- Sponsored by Representative Battles of the 15th District.
